5 ландшафтная архитектура
ландшафтная архитектура
—
[ http://www.eionet.europa.eu/gemet/alphabetic?langcode=en]EN
landscape architecture
The creation, development, and decorative planting of gardens, grounds, parks, and other outdoor spaces. Landscape gardening is used to enhance nature helping to create a natural setting for individual residences and buildings, and even towns, particularly where special approaches and central settings are required. (Source: GILP96)
